Sydney to Jeddah flights

With over 151 flights every week and 10 different airlines you have a wide range of options. While flying to Jeddah from Sydney you will be doing a stopover in Kuala Lumpur, Dubai or any other of the 10 alternatives with flight connections.

Are there any non-stop flights from SYD to JED?

There are no direct or non-stop flights from Kingsford Smith International Airport, SYD to King Abdulaziz International Airport, JED.

Sydney to Jeddah with Emirates

If you fly from Sydney with Emirates you will do a stopover in Dubai, DXB before reaching Jeddah. This flight trip will take 19 hours and 35 minutes and you can fly every weekday with departures at 6:00 am, 8:00 pm or 9:00 pm.

Distance & flight times: Sydney Airport to King Abdulaziz International Airport

The shortest flight time between SYD and JED is 19 hours and 20 minutes.

ViaTotal flight timeLayover timeDistance
KUL Kuala Lumpur19h 20m1h 40m8529 miles (13723 km)
DXB Dubai19h 35m2h 25m8587 miles (13816 km)
SIN Singapore19h 40m1h 50m8531 miles (13726 km)
AUH Abu Dhabi19h 55m2h 35m8545 miles (13749 km)
DOH Doha20h 15m2h 0m8563 miles (13778 km)
CGK Jakarta20h 20m2h 35m8429 miles (13562 km)
DPS Denpasar21h 20m1h 25m8478 miles (13641 km)
HKT Phuket21h 30m3h 10m8598 miles (13834 km)
MNL Manila23h 50m4h 40m9283 miles (14936 km)
CAN Guangzhou24h 20m4h 20m9406 miles (15134 km)
The flight times and layover times in the table above are approximate and may vary depending on flight number, aircraft, airline, weather, and time of day.SYD-JED flight routesSydney to Jeddah flight routes illustrated on a map.

A codeshare agreement means that cooperating airlines are able to sell seats on each other’s flights. This means that you are able to travel to more destinations than your airline of choice normally offers. Codeshare flights are also beneficial because of the seamless transits you can get with connecting flights from the same airline. The downside of choosing a codeshare flight can be that you in some cases can’t upgrade codeshare flights or use elite benefits.

A connecting or transit flight means that you reach your final destination through two or more flights – in other words a non-direct flight. You will change to a new aircraft after your first flight, this may include moving to another terminal at the airport aswell. The time required to transfer passengers and luggage between flights is called Minimum Connecting Time (MCT) and are always taken into account here on Flightroutes.com.

If you bought your whole flight on a single ticket, the airline will book you on the next available connecting flight.

With connecting flights, checked in luggage is most commonly forwarded to your final destination when buying a single ticket for both flights.

If you miss your connecting flight due to circumstances outside your control such as your first flight being delayed, you should turn to your airline who will provide you with a seat on the next available flight. This is usually done free of charge, and only applies if you purchased your trip as one ticket. If the next connecting flight is the following day, the airline usually provides accommodation and meals.
